    i think trucks should only be measured/raced in the 1/4 mile with 80,000lbs gross and a van trailer. AND they need to pass a legal DOT type inspection before allowed to race.


    Because without that, you get into "trucks" that have single axle(with car slicks), no fifth wheel, jet engines, etc. So at that point how do you define a class 8 truck?
